I had a right-side mastectomy four weeks ago & for the last two weeks I have had a sharp pain in my forearm when I straighten my arm. Also an aching wrist which is worsened by using the mouse.
When I asked about this at the hospital they seemed to think it was nothing to so with the operation but it must be somehow related to the operation. The arm looks normal and since I only had a few lymph nodes out they said there was not much danger of lymphodema.
After my previous surgery (wide local excision) I had cording - a pain on the inside of my elbow when I lifted my arm and a weird stretched flap of skin in my armpit which was like there was an actual cord in there which was pulled too tight. The surgeon said to do the exercises and it would get better in a few months & it actually got better sooner than that.
